    PREPAID ENERGY METER The present system of energy billing is error prone and also time and labor consuming. Errors get introduced at every stage of energy billing like errors with electro-mechanical meters‚ human errors while noting down the meter reading‚ and errors while processing the paid bills and the due bills.
